Hair and nails, glitter and gloss, short skirts... Generation Z is reclaiming long-discredited stereotypes and reinventing women's fashion- It’s a new wave that includes the queer community and questions traditional ideals of beauty. Tracks investigates hyperfemininity and asks whether this reinterpretation can be subversive and empowering.
